KATE O’BRIEN (Dublin)  M.A. (HONS.) DRAMATHERAPY

DRAMATHERAPIST/ORGANISATIONAL CONSULTANT

Kate O’Brien qualified as a Dramatherapist in 2004 with a Masters
degree from the National University of Maynooth.  She is a member of the
Irish Association of Creative Arts Therapists (IACAT).  In 2000 she
completed the Advanced Course in Group Analysis in St. Vincent’s
University Hospital, Dublin and is an associate member of the Irish Group
Analytic Society (IGAS).

During the past decade Kate has worked as a consultant, providing
training, advisory and support services to individuals and organisations
working in the following sectors:

•        Community Projects
•        Learning Disability
•        Mental Health
•        Acquired Physical Disability
•        Addiction Services

Kate is also a qualified nurse and midwife.  She is co-founder of Phagos
Training, a consultancy organisation providing training in group work and
management skills, team development, role consultation and
organisational development.

She runs her own private therapy practice and is also available to
provide training and advisory services.

ANGELA PALMER (Cork) MA (HONS) DRAMATHERAPY

DRAMATHERAPIST//FAMILY THERAPIST/COUNSELLOR

Angela Palmer qualified as a Dramatherapist in 2004 with a MA degree
from the National University of Maynooth. She is a member of the Irish
Association of Creative Arts Therapists (IACAT)

In 2002, she completed a Higher Diploma in Integrative Psychotherapy in
U.C.C  and in 2000 completed her family therapy training overseas. She
also holds a certificate in Social Work.

During the past decade Angela has trained and worked with an
organisation called Connect  which is affiliated with the Tavistock in
London. She also taught  drama abroad for many years.
